How Solar Panels Work
At the core of solar energy technology are solar panels, which convert sunlight into electricity. Here’s a simplified breakdown of the process:
1. Photovoltaic Cells: Solar panels are made up of many photovoltaic (PV) cells. When sunlight hits these cells, it excites electrons, creating an electric current.
2. Inverter: The direct current (DC) produced by the PV cells is then converted into alternating current (AC) by an inverter, making it usable for home appliances.
3. Energy Usage: The generated electricity can either be used immediately, stored in batteries, or fed back into the grid, often allowing homeowners to earn credits on their electricity bills.
Practical Examples of Solar Panel Use
Solar panels are not just theoretical; they are being utilized in various settings. Here are a few practical examples:
– Residential Homes: Many homeowners install solar panels on rooftops to reduce their electricity bills. For instance, a typical home with a solar system can save anywhere from $10,000 to $30,000 over 20 years.
– Commercial Buildings: Businesses are increasingly adopting solar energy to cut operational costs. Large installations can significantly reduce energy expenses and improve sustainability credentials.
– Community Solar Projects: These initiatives allow multiple households to share the benefits of a single solar installation, making solar energy accessible to those who may not have suitable roofs.
Benefits of Solar Energy
The advantages of solar panels extend beyond just financial savings. Here are some key benefits:
- Environmental Impact: Solar energy is clean and renewable, reducing reliance on fossil fuels and lowering greenhouse gas emissions.
- Energy Independence: By generating your own electricity, you become less dependent on utility companies and their fluctuating rates.
- Increased Property Value: Homes with solar installations often see an increase in property value, making them more attractive to potential buyers.
- Government Incentives: Many regions offer tax credits, rebates, and other incentives to encourage solar adoption, making it more financially viable.
Challenges and Limitations
While solar panels offer numerous benefits, they are not without challenges. Here are some limitations to consider:
- High Initial Costs: The upfront cost of purchasing and installing solar panels can be significant, though financing options are available.
- Weather Dependency: Solar energy production is contingent on sunlight, meaning efficiency can drop on cloudy or rainy days.
- Space Requirements: Solar panels require adequate roof space or land, which may not be available for all homeowners.
- Maintenance Costs: While generally low, there can be costs associated with maintaining and cleaning solar panels over time.
Cost-Benefit Analysis
To better understand the financial implications, here’s a simple cost-benefit analysis:
| Item | Estimated Cost/Savings |
|---|---|
| Average Installation Cost | $15,000 – $30,000 |
| Average Annual Savings on Electricity Bills | $1,000 – $2,000 |
| Payback Period | 5 – 10 years |
| Increased Property Value | Up to $15,000 |
In summary, while solar panels come with upfront costs and some limitations, the long-term benefits can be substantial. By weighing these factors, you can determine if solar energy is a worthwhile investment for your situation.

Myth Debunked
One common myth is that solar panels are ineffective in cloudy or rainy climates. While it’s true that solar panels generate less energy in such conditions, they can still produce a significant amount of electricity. In fact, many regions with less sunlight have successfully adopted solar technology and seen substantial benefits.
